  • How do you do QA? (or do you do QA?)
    There are services such as https://betafamily.com/ if you don't have in-house testers. Having in-house people "go through the whole app and look for bugs" sounds like a nightmare, and I'm not surprised it's hard to get people to do it. I recommend that each task has well defined acceptance criteria, and you have someone who did not work on the task run a compiled build of the app and confirm that the build...
